Transaction

3bba046ad30267cf2bbd57b68478ab7027d9e3f11ac20d3d3b62dc1754ffaf5e

Summary

In Block483301
TimeThu, 14 Dec 2023 08:36:45 UTC
Total Input2156.98060097 Nebula
Total Output2156.98053737 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
225836 Confirmations2156.98053737 Nebula
Raw Transaction